What is a phone QR code and how does it work

A phone QR code is a scannable square that, when a phone camera reads it, opens the dialer with your number already entered; the user just taps Call. Under the hood it is a QR code encoding the RFC 3966 tel URI scheme. Phone numbers should follow the ITU-T E.164 numbering plan (e.g. +15551234567) for universal dialer compatibility. Supported natively on every iOS, Android, macOS and Windows device since 2010.

What's the difference between a phone QR code and a vCard QR?

A phone QR opens the dialer with your number ready, the user reviews and taps Call. A vCard QR saves your full contact card (name, phone, email, address) to the address book. Phone QR is one-action call. vCard is full contact save. Different intent, different format.

Can a QR code dial an extension automatically?

Add a comma after the main number to insert a one-second pause, then the extension digits. The dialer waits, then sends the extension tones. Format: tel:+15551234567,,123. Most modern dialers handle multiple commas for longer pauses on automated phone trees in customer support flows.

Do phone QR codes work on both iPhone and Android?

The RFC 3966 tel URI scheme is supported natively on every iOS, Android, macOS and Windows device since 2010. Modern phones scan from the camera app, no extra app required. Scan reliability is near-universal across major manufacturers and lighting conditions.

Phone QR vs SMS QR: when should I use each one?

A phone QR opens the dialer for an immediate voice call, best when the customer needs urgent help and a real person on the line. An SMS QR pops a text draft with recipient and body pre-filled, best for asynchronous opt-in flows, RSVP keywords like JOIN, or when customers want to attach photos. Phone is synchronous voice. SMS is asynchronous text. Many service businesses print both side by side and let the customer pick.
